20 Chapter 2. Learning the basics „Using passwords Using passwords helps prevent your computer from being used by others. Once you set a password and enable it, a prompt appears on the screen each time you power on the computer. Enter your password at the prompt. The computer cannot be used unless you enter the correct password. For details about how to set the password, see the help to the right of the screen in BIOS Setup Utility. 22 Chapter 2. Learning the basics „Inserting a memory card 1Push the dummy card until you hear a click. Gently pull the dummy card out of the memory card slot. 2Slide the memory card in until it clicks into place. „Removing a memory card 1Push the memory card until you hear a click. 2Gently pull the memory card out of the memory card slot. Chapter 2. Learning the basics 25 „Starting Lenovo Quick Start To launch Lenovo Quick Start, do the following: Turn off the computer. Press the QS button. Lenovo Quick Start screen will appear within a few seconds. „Exiting Lenovo Quick Start Click to restart the computer to the main operating system. Click to turn off the computer.
